CALL OF DUTY MOBILE GOES BIG WITH INDIA CHALLENGE 2020

CALL OF DUTY MOBILE GOES BIG WITH INDIA CHALLENGE 2020 

New Delhi, 24 November 2020: South Asia’s leading esports company NODWIN Gaming announced it’s first-ever standalone Call of Duty Mobile tournament, the Call of Duty Mobile India Challenge 2020 with a prize pool of more than 7 Lacs INR. The registration for the tournament has kick-started on November 20 and the matches will go live on NODWIN Gaming’s YouTube and Facebook handles.

The record-breaking Activision Blizzard title found instant success within one month of its release and even now sees no stopping. With India in full swing for mobile esports welcomed the game with a warm heart. With the Call of Duty Mobile India Challenge, NODWIN Gaming aims at building a robust ecosystem for the game and its community in the country.   

“Call of Duty mobile had its takers from day 1 and the number grew at a substantial pace in India. Our mobile-first esports market grew diverse with its arrival. A full-blown CODM tournament was long overdue, we heard the community and it eventually happened. We are glad to have made this move and I’m sure this will be a wonderful platform for the gamers to make a name for themselves”, said Akshat Rathee, MD & Co-Founder, NODWIN Gaming.  

The property is driven by invitational tournaments and open cups. India’s celebrity gamers fought hard in the invitational tournament for a prize pool of 72,000 INR. The cups are open for everyone to register and participate. There will be a total of 4 cups for 5v5 and battle royale modes combined for a total prize pool of 6,48,000 INR. The winners of the cups for both the modes will move on to the grand finals set to take place on 28th December.
